About Overture Maps Foundation:
Overture Maps Foundation is the leading developer of open map data for mapping applicastions and spatial analytics. It is organized under the Linux Foundation. Overture is dedicated to building a thriving community accelerating the adoption of our data and GERS framework and strengthening the ecosystem through engagement and collaboration. Job Description
Overture Maps Foundation is seeking a Senior DevOps Engineer to ensure the reliability automation and observability of our open data pipelines. You’ll manage the systems that keep large-scale geospatial data pipelines running smoothly across cloud environments design and maintain CI/CD workflows in GitHub and implement best practices for deployment and operational excellence. This role bridges development and operations supporting a common platform-agnostic technology stack while maintaining flexibility for member contributions.
This role is ideal for someone who wants to build the foundation for reliable scalable and repeatable open data operations. You’ll be at the center of Overture’s technical ecosystem ensuring pipelines run smoothly automation is trusted and releases happen seamlessly across environments.
Key Responsibilities
Pipeline Reliability
-
Maintain and monitor production data pipelines to ensure consistent on-time runs.
-
Troubleshoot and resolve operational issues across development staging and production environments.
-
Implement logging alerting and metrics for end-to-end observability.
-
Manage pipeline configurations scheduling and environment consistency.
CI/CD and Automation
-
Design and manage CI/CD workflows in GitHub for building testing and deploying pipeline components.
-
Enforce consistent branching testing and release practices across repositories.
-
Automate build test and deployment workflows for both code and data releases.
-
Support versioning and reproducibility for datasets and schema changes.
-
Ensure pipelines and supporting systems are deployable across both AWS and Azure environments.
Infrastructure Management
-
Coordinate with CloudOps to manage cloud infrastructure for pipeline execution following Overture’s platform-agnostic guidance.
-
Maintain reproducible environments and ensure secure efficient use of compute and storage resources.
-
Work across Engineering Operations to schedule and optimize compute resources ensuring cost efficiency security and scalability of cloud-based data systems.
-
Implement infrastructure and operational automation to reduce manual intervention.
Release Ops Support
-
Support Release Operations by integrating QA/QC validation into CI/CD processes.
-
Partner with ReleaseOps to validate release candidates and monitor data QA/QC jobs.
-
Automate post-release tasks such as metadata updates or data viewer refreshes.
-
Maintain operational runbooks and documentation for release reliability and repeatability.
Qualifications
Required
-
4+ years of experience in Data Engineering DevOps or related engineering operations roles.
-
Hands-on experience operating distributed pipelines built with Airflow Spark and Python or Scala.
-
Strong knowledge of GitHub workflows CI/CD automation and multi-environment deployments.
-
Familiarity with data platforms that use SparkSQL Iceberg Parquet and object storage (S3 or Azure Blob).
-
Solid understanding of monitoring alerting and release automation.
Preferred
-
Experience with LakeFS for feed version management.
-
Familiarity with Sedona Shapely or other spatial libraries.
Understanding of data QA/QC processes and release operations workflows.
